Lozanne

Lozanne is a common French, located in the department of the the Rhone and the area the Rhone-Alps. Its inhabitants is called Lozannais.

History

  • According to the most probable version, the name of Lozanne would come from Hosanna sung the day of the Branches.
  • Lozanne was a long time an important relay of Diligence on the Route of Lyon - Echarmeaux; then, the Railroad gradually took over starting from 1866, year of the opening of the Gare. Paid vacations of 1936 made village a place of predilection for the Sunday walks, the fishing and the meals in its famous restaurants.

Places and monuments

  • the current church Romance, with its Clocher of the 13th century would be the enlarging of a Chapelle of the 6th century, for proof the fact that it was placed under the term of Maurice Saint, Martyr at the 3rd century that a Peinture represents outside, above the large gate. Inside the church, to see a liturgical Swimming pool, used in the olden days for the baptisms by immersion.
